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has asserted that Iran currently lacks the capacity to enrich uranium or produce ballistic missiles as the conflict involving the United States and Israel continues for nearly three weeks. This statement, delivered during a period of increasing military engagement, underscores Israel’s strategy to exploit perceived weaknesses within Iran’s leadership. Although Netanyahu’s remarks suggest a confident posture, it is crucial to consider the broader implications for regional security and diplomatic relations.
In recent weeks, Israel has intensified its military operations, leading to significant international attention and scrutiny. Analysts note that Netanyahu’s comments may be designed not only to bolster Israel’s domestic support but also to influence international perceptions regarding Iran’s military capabilities. By emphasizing Iran’s alleged weaknesses, Israel aims to consolidate its position as a regional power and deter any potential threats from neighboring states.
